The electrical resistivity of various aluminum sheet alloys can vary depending on the specific alloy composition. Generally, aluminum alloys have relatively low resistivity values compared to other metals, such as copper or steel. The resistivity of aluminum alloys typically ranges from 2.7 to 3.0 × 10^-8 ohm-meters. The impact of electrical resistivity on electrical applications is significant. Low resistivity in aluminum alloys allows for efficient flow of electrical current, reducing energy losses and promoting better conductivity. This makes aluminum alloys suitable for a wide range of electrical applications, including power transmission lines, electrical wiring, electronic components, and heat sinks. The low resistivity of aluminum alloys also contributes to their lightweight nature, making them an attractive choice for industries where weight reduction is crucial, such as aerospace and automotive sectors. However, it is important to note that the resistivity can slightly vary depending on the specific alloy used, so it is essential to consider the desired electrical properties when selecting an aluminum alloy for a specific application.

The best practices for recycling aluminum sheets to maintain material quality include ensuring proper sorting and separation of different alloys, removing any contaminants or coatings, minimizing the introduction of impurities during the recycling process, employing efficient melting and refining techniques, and regularly monitoring and testing the quality of the recycled aluminum to meet industry standards. Additionally, promoting consumer awareness and participation in aluminum recycling programs can help maintain material quality by encouraging the correct disposal and recycling of aluminum sheets.
